Editorial Reviews

From Publishers Weekly
For anyone who's ever dreamed of finding a cash windfall, Grippando's (The Abduction) new crime novel offers a cautionary tale of greed, family secrets and the dangers of getting what you wish for. Just before Frank Duffy dies, he tells his physician son, Ryan, that there is $2 million hidden in the attic, and that Frank got the money through blackmail?albeit off someone who "deserved it." The level-headed Ryan considers both claims unbelievable?until he finds the money. What secrets had his mild-mannered, hard-working father been hiding? Meanwhile, Amy Parkins, while struggling to support her daughter and her grandmother and to put herself through law school, receives $200,000 from an anonymous benefactor, apparently Frank Duffy, whom she'd never met. Why? Could the gift have anything to do with her mother's mysterious suicide 20 years earlier? Troubled by the criminal implications of his father's legacy, Ryan decides he can't touch the cash until he knows where it came from. His questions kick off a wild ride involving lawyers and guns, Panamanian banks, seductive strangers and too much FBI interest for comfort. Amy, too, tries to trace the money, putting her on a collision course with Ryan and his greed-maddened family. As Ryan and Amy search for the money's source and meaning, they uncover a conspiracy involving high-ranking government officials, multi-billion-dollar corporations and a hidden crime committed on a hot summer night years ago. The final revelation is a real kicker, but it would carry even more force if overly tricky plot contrivances hadn't diluted the suspense of what came before.

From Library Journal
Grippando (The Abduction, LJ 3/15/98) has done it again, crafting a thrilling scenario filled with terrifying images of money's dark side. Dr. Ryan Duffy returns home to attend his father's funeral, expecting to console his mother. Instead, his father's dying words, wrought with allusions to blackmail, encourage Ryan to seek out an unexpected pile of cash squirreled away in the attic. Mom is not talking about the millions there, and Ryan's pregnant sister and abusive brother-in-law turn sinister. Meanwhile, single mom Amy Parkens receives an anonymous package from the dying Duffy Senior?$200,000 in cash in a crockpot box. Amy traces the money to the Duffys through the crockpot warranty, and this results in an immediate but wary attraction between Amy and Ryan. The pair circle around a decades-old mystery involving their parents and those they considered their most trusted friends and allies. Highly recommended.
-?Susan A. Zappia, Maricopa Cty. Lib. Dist., Phoenix

5.0 out of 5 stars A FAST-PACED, INTELLIGENT THRILLER, May 7, 2000
Amy Parkens is a single mom struggling to raise her young daughter. One day a mysterious package containing $200,000.00 appears on her doorstep.

Ryan Duffy is a divorced doctor, his dying father has revealed to him there is 2 million dollars hidden in their attic.

Amy begins searching to find out who sent the money and why.

Ryan begins to search his father's past to find out who his father was blackmailing and why.

The search brings Amy and Ryan together...What is the connection between the two, and is there a connection to Amy's mother's suicide many years earlier?

You will turn the pages FAST to uncover the answers to these questions

James Grippando is an author whose talent for coming up with clever, page-turning plots is endless.

"Found Money" moves at the speed of a runaway train, and the climax is a shocker.

This book is a MUST read!

5.0 out of 5 stars James Grippando excels with "Found Money", January 24, 1999
By A Customer
This review is from: Found Money (Hardcover)
What would you do if someone delivered a package to your door containing $200,000? Would you stash it away or would you launch a search to find out where the money originated? This is the plot in James Grippando's new novel "Found Money" (HarperCollins $25). When I first began to read "Found Money" I found the plot a bit irritating. After all, wouldn't you want to secure the cash before jeopardizing it by asking questions? But Grippando is such a talented writer I had to see where he was going with the story. I'm glad I did because he weaves a fully believable tale that will stay with you long after you finish the book. "Found Money" begins when Amy Parkins finds $200,000 in cash in a cardboard box delivered to her door. In the meantine, Ryan Duffy inherits a fortune from his penniless father. Amy and Ryan, who have never met, soon cross paths to discover that found money can be a treasure or an atrocity. Ryan and Amy discover horrifying crimes that touched their families years ago and must solve a perilous puzzle to learn the truth. Just when you think you have read Grippando's best work, he tops it with another spellbinding novel that will keep you reading well into the night to reach the dramatic conclusion.
